hade same message and warning light come up on first day i got my car worked out it had a faulty throttle body. reason why i it says stop start unavalible apparently is becuase stop start deactivates when there is a issue with the engine so the stop start does not damage it further.

The Start/stop will sometimes come up and say that, even if there isn't really a problem. If you unplug your seatbelt for example, or if you have reversed. But after driving forward again, it will come back.

stop and start will become unavalibe for sevral reasons engine fault, battery needs 80%+ charge so if you have radio on with aircon full beams etc all at same time it will not work, also if the engines not up to temprature it will not always work there were also some other reasons we were told on my course but cant quiet remember them. :)
